## Local Setup

Welcome, plugin authors. The Thumbwick queue processes thumbnail jobs for the Lanternfox media suite. Install dependencies with `npm install`, then start the worker via `npm run dev`. Plugins are loaded from the `extensions/` directory at boot, so place yours there before starting. The worker needs a job-tracking database; for local development, configure it with the following.

primary connection of yagep-kahip = redis://giliel_svc:zYiKsLL2PLpfPL@db-348f.xolmarsys.corp:5432/fenwyn

Management Meeting Minutes — Reseller Programme

Present: Dena Forsgate, Ollie Rennick, Priya Calloway.

Quick recap: the Fernlight reseller programme is tracking ahead of plan — 14 partners signed versus the 10 we'd hoped for. Margins are a bit thinner than modelled, mostly down to the tiered discount we offered early joiners. Ollie will tighten the discount bands before the next intake. Where we want to take the programme next is covered in the note below.

board note of yahip-tadug: Headcount on the Zorath team goes from 9 to 100 by the end of April. Gross margin on Zorath came in at 10 percent against a plan of 20 percent.

Minutes — Management Meeting, Warranty Review (Delverow Appliances)

Attendees reviewed the warranty-cost overrun on the Kestrel dryer line, now 31% above forecast. Root cause traced to a heating-element supplier change made last spring. Remediation: revert supplier, extend affected warranties, and accrue an additional reserve. The incoming director will own the recovery plan from next month. Full figures are appended separately. The confidential note below summarises the forward plan.

board note of bawep-tajef: Queniusek Systems plans to raise the Quenvan list price by 53.1 percent in March. The pricing group signed off on a budget of $176.4 million for Project Drueth. The renewal with Casionix Partners closes at $142.5 million a year, 8.3 percent below the last contract. Project Fraax slips by six weeks because of the tooling delay.